1. Introduction: What are Small-Batch CNC Aluminum Products?
Small-batch CNC aluminum products refer to high-precision aluminum components manufactured in small quantities (typically ranging from a few pieces to several hundred, and sometimes up to 1000 pieces for specific niche needs) using Computer Numerical Control (CNC) machining technology. Unlike large-batch production that focuses on mass standardization and cost reduction through scale, small-batch CNC aluminum products prioritize flexibility, customization, and precision, perfectly bridging the gap between prototype development and large-scale manufacturing.
This manufacturing method combines the unique advantages of aluminum—lightweight, excellent machinability, corrosion resistance, and high thermal conductivity—with the precision and automation of CNC machining. It is widely adopted by startups, R&D teams, and specialized manufacturers who need to test product designs, meet niche market demands, or avoid the high costs of large-scale production tooling.
2. Core Focus of Small-Batch CNC Aluminum Products
The core of small-batch CNC aluminum products lies in balancing precision, flexibility, and cost-effectiveness, which distinguishes them from large-batch production and traditional manual processing. The key focuses are as follows:
2.1 High Precision and Consistency
CNC machining technology enables small-batch CNC aluminum products to achieve micron-level precision, with tolerances stably controlled between ±0.001-0.01mm, meeting the strict requirements of high-end industries. Unlike manual processing, which is prone to human error, CNC machining relies on digital programming and automated operation to ensure that each component in the small batch has consistent dimensions and performance.
2.2 Flexibility and Customization
Flexibility is the biggest advantage of small-batch CNC aluminum products. Unlike large-batch production, which requires expensive molds and long setup times, small-batch CNC machining can quickly switch production plans according to design changes or customer needs by modifying the CNC program without additional mold costs.
2.3 Cost Optimization for Small-Scale Demand
The core focus of small-batch CNC aluminum products also includes cost control for small-scale demand. Small-batch CNC machining avoids high mold costs, reduces upfront investment, and allows enterprises to produce only the quantity they need. Through DFM analysis and material nesting optimization, the material utilization rate can be increased to more than 92%, further reducing production costs.

3. Key Roles of Small-Batch CNC Aluminum Products in Industries
Small-batch CNC aluminum products play an irreplaceable role in promoting industrial innovation, optimizing production efficiency, and meeting diverse market needs. Their key roles are reflected in multiple industries:
3.1 Accelerating R&D and Prototype Verification
In the product R&D stage, enterprises need to test and verify product designs repeatedly. Small-batch CNC aluminum products can quickly produce small batches of prototypes, helping R&D teams verify the rationality of product structure, performance, and assembly, and find design defects in a timely manner.
3.2 Meeting Niche Market and Customized Demand
Many industries have niche market demands with small order quantities but high customization requirements. Small-batch CNC aluminum products can meet these demands by providing customized processing services, helping enterprises seize niche market opportunities and gain competitive advantages.
3.3 Supporting Emergency Production and Spare Parts Supply
In industries such as aerospace, automotive, and industrial equipment, equipment failure often requires emergency replacement of spare parts. Small-batch CNC aluminum products can quickly produce small batches of spare parts, shortening the downtime of equipment, reducing economic losses, and ensuring the smooth operation of production.
3.4 Promoting Innovation in High-Tech Industries
High-tech industries such as aerospace, electronics, and robotics have high requirements for the precision and performance of aluminum components. Small-batch CNC aluminum products can provide high-precision, customized components that meet the special needs of these industries, promoting technological innovation and product upgrading.
4. Key Benefits of Small-Batch CNC Aluminum Products
Compared with traditional large-batch production and manual processing, small-batch CNC aluminum products have obvious advantages, bringing tangible benefits to enterprises:
4.1 Low Upfront Investment and Reduced Risk
Large-batch production requires expensive mold manufacturing. Small-batch CNC aluminum products do not require mold manufacturing, only need to program the CNC machine tool, which greatly reduces upfront investment and business risks.
4.2 Fast Production Cycle and Short Time-to-Market
The setup time of small-batch CNC machining is short, and the production process is automated. small-batch CNC aluminum products can shorten the production cycle by 30%-50%, allowing products to enter the market faster and gain a competitive edge.
4.3 High Precision and Stable Quality
CNC machining uses digital control technology, which avoids human errors in manual processing and ensures that each component in the small batch has consistent precision and quality, meeting the strict requirements of high-end industries.
4.4 Strong Flexibility and Adaptability
Small-batch CNC aluminum products can quickly adjust production plans according to changes in customer needs or design schemes by adjusting the CNC program without additional costs or time delays.
4.5 Cost-Effectiveness for Small-Scale Demand
For small-scale demand (a few pieces to several hundred pieces), small-batch CNC aluminum products are more cost-effective than large-batch production, producing on demand, minimizing inventory costs and material waste.

6. Industry FAQs About Small-Batch CNC Aluminum Products
Q1: What is the quantity range of small-batch CNC aluminum products?
A: The quantity range is usually 1-1000 pieces, mainly used to distinguish from large-batch production (usually more than 10,000 pieces) that relies on molds.
Q2: What aluminum alloys are most commonly used?
A: 6061-T6 (versatile, good machinability & corrosion resistance) and 7075-T6 (high strength for aerospace).
Q3: What is the precision level?
A: Tolerance ±0.001-0.01mm, surface roughness Ra 0.1-0.8μm, adjustable based on customer requirements.
Q4: How long is the production cycle?
A: Usually 1-7 days. Simple parts (<50 pieces): 1-2 days; complex high-precision parts: 3-7 days.
Q5: Is it more cost-effective than large-batch production?
A: For 1-1000 pieces: yes (no mold cost). For over 10,000 pieces: large-batch has scale advantage.
Q6: What surface treatments are available?
A: Anodizing, sandblasting, polishing, electroplating — customized for performance and appearance.
Q7: Can it meet high-end industry needs?
A: Yes. It fully meets strict requirements of aerospace, medical equipment, precision instruments and other high-end fields.
